WebFor flour, you divide the number of grams by 125. For sugar, you divide the number of grams by 201. For butter, you divide the number of grams by 227. A 12-ounce can of “original” Coke ... reactsysWebSep 30, 2024 · According to the USDA, on average, an American adult eats 17 teaspoons (68 grams) of added sugar per day. This amount is more than the 2024-2025 Dietary Guidelines for Americans, which recommend limiting calories from added sugars to less than 10% per day. That's 12 teaspoons or 48 grams of sugar if following a 2,000-calorie-per-day diet. reacttext type
